FMB001 is an advanced Plug and Play OBDII tracker with GNSS, GSM, and Bluetooth connectivity. It is perfectly suitable for tracking light vehicles in applications such as courier delivery service, car rental and leasing, insurance telematics, and many others where simple integration is essential. Additionally, it has an additional feature: reading OBDII data from the onboard computer of vehicles. The FMB001 device supports temperature/humidity sensors, hands-free, firmware update, and configuration via Bluetooth.

GNSS
GPS GNSS, GLONASS, GALILEO, BEIDOU, SBAS, QZSS, DGPS, AGPS
33-channel receiver
Tracking sensitivity -165 dBM
Precision <3 m
Hot start <1 s
Warm start <25 s
Cold start <35 s
CELLULAR
GSM technology
2G Quadband 850/900/1800/1900 MHz
Data transfer GPRS Multi-Slot Class 12 (up to 240 kbps)
SMS data support (text / data)
POWER
Input voltage range 10-30 V DC with overvoltage protection
170 mAh backup battery 3.7 V lithium-ion battery (0.63 Wh)
Power consumption at 12V <5 mA (ultra deep sleep)
At 12V <7 mA (deep sleep)
At 12V <7 mA (online suspension)
At 12V <8 mA (GPS Sleep)
At 12V <28 mA (nominal)
